One Atlantic, one of Atlantic City's premiere wedding venues, is sadly closing its doors. Unfortunately, the word is that the popular South Jersey wedding venue located on the pier outside Caesar's just couldn't recover from the havoc that was wreaked by the COVID-19 pandemic. Of course, they're not the only business that had to close up shop due to COVID-19, but it's sad that such a beloved place literally in the business of celebrating love couldn't bounce back.

A husband-and-wife photography team who are vendors of the venue said in their blog that they hope another interested party will come forward to take ownership of the place. If that indeed does happen, then maybe the doors of One Atlantic won't be closed for too long.

If you're wondering what happens now for the people who had weddings on the books there, well, the only thing you can do is pray they had wedding insurance. If there's anything the pandemic taught us, it's the importance of having some sort of protection for the thousands of dollars people spend on their wedding day. As we all saw over the past year or two, just because you put the deposit down, doesn't mean the big day's going to happen.

Still, maybe One Atlantic will open their doors again someday. For now, it's time to say goodbye. One Atlantic will be officially closing up shop on November 30, 2021.
